A Journey Through Time: The Heart of Kandy

As I embarked on the Kandy City Tour, I was immediately struck by the palpable sense of history that enveloped the city. Kandy, the last royal capital of Sri Lanka, is a place where the past and present coexist in a harmonious dance. The city, nestled in a valley surrounded by lush hills, offers a unique blend of cultural richness and natural beauty.

Our first stop was the Temple of the Sacred Tooth Relic, a site of immense spiritual significance. The temple, with its golden roof and intricate carvings, is a testament to the architectural prowess of ancient Sri Lankan craftsmen. As I walked through the temple complex, I was reminded of the deep reverence that Buddhism holds in this part of the world. The air was thick with the scent of incense, and the sound of chanting monks created a serene atmosphere that was both humbling and uplifting.

The temple houses a sacred relic, a tooth of the Buddha, which is kept in a gold casket. Although the relic itself is not visible, the energy and devotion of the pilgrims who come to pay their respects is palpable. It was a moment of reflection, a reminder of the enduring power of faith and tradition.

The Art of Tea: A Visit to the Geragama Tea Factory

Leaving the spiritual heart of Kandy, our journey took us to the Geragama Tea Factory, one of the oldest in Sri Lanka. As someone who grew up in a multicultural household, I have always been fascinated by the way different cultures approach the art of tea. The visit to the tea factory was a delightful exploration of this beloved beverage’s journey from leaf to cup.

The factory tour offered a fascinating insight into the tea-making process, from the careful plucking of the leaves to the intricate steps of drying, rolling, and fermenting. The aroma of fresh tea leaves filled the air, and I couldn’t help but feel a sense of appreciation for the craftsmanship involved in creating the perfect cup of tea.

Tasting the different varieties of tea was a highlight of the visit. Each sip was a journey in itself, revealing the subtle nuances and flavors that make Sri Lankan tea so renowned. It was a reminder of the simple pleasures in life and the importance of taking the time to savor them.

Nature’s Masterpiece: The Royal Botanical Gardens

Our final stop was the Royal Botanical Gardens, a sprawling oasis of greenery that once served as the pleasure gardens of Kandyan royalty. As I wandered through the gardens, I was captivated by the sheer diversity of plant life on display. From the towering Burma bamboo to the delicate orchids, each corner of the garden offered a new discovery.

The gardens are a testament to the beauty and diversity of Sri Lanka’s natural heritage. Walking along the stately avenue of royal palms, I felt a deep sense of connection to the land and its history. The giant Javan fig tree, with its sprawling canopy, was a particular highlight, offering a shady retreat from the midday sun.

As I sat beneath its branches, I reflected on the day’s journey. The Kandy City Tour had been a rich tapestry of experiences, weaving together the threads of history, culture, and nature. It was a reminder of the importance of preserving these treasures for future generations and the joy of discovering them anew.
